Vietnam aims to attract 750,000 international medical tourists by 2030, with oral diagnosis and treatment being one of the popular cross-border services.

DentalGoodNews|Recently, the Vietnamese Ministry of Health disclosed the "Draft Plan for Medical Tourism Development 2026-2030" (hereinafter referred to as the "Draft Plan"), proposing a target of attracting approximately 750,000 international medical tourists by 2030. Currently, local oral aesthetics has been listed as one of the services favored by international medical tourists. The Draft Plan aims to expand service areas including modern medicine, traditional medicine and pharmacy, rehabilitation, comprehensive healthcare, and elderly care. The Vietnamese government intends to enhance industry competitiveness through establishing a national brand and forming a medical tourism association.

According to data disclosed by Ha Anh Duc, Director of the Medical Services Administration under the Vietnamese Ministry of Health, Vietnam's medical tourism currently attracts approximately 300,000 foreign residents and international visitors annually, with related total expenditure estimated at USD 1-2 billion per year. At present, Ho Chi Minh City receives about 40% of international medical tourists, followed by Hanoi. Cities such as Da Nang, Hue, and Khanh Hoa are gradually developing medical tourism products by leveraging their advantages in resort tourism and traditional medicine.

Within specific segments, dental treatment has become one of the popular service areas attracting international patients. According to a report by the Australian Broadcasting Corporation (ABC) on September 6, 2026, an increasing number of Australian patients are turning to Vietnam due to prohibitive local dental costs. Taking Adelaide resident Wendy Middleton as an example, her dental treatment quote in Australia was approximately AUD 40,000, while the full package in Vietnam, including surgery, airfare, accommodation, and visa, cost about one-third of the Australian quote.

Local dental institutions in Vietnam are also actively conducting targeted marketing toward overseas markets. The "Australian Dental Clinic," located in Hanoi and Da Nang, was established in 2006 and is one of the first local clinics serving foreigners and tourists. The clinic's manager, Nguyen Nam, stated that visitor traffic from Australia has been continuously increasing recently. Statistics from the Vietnamese Ministry of Health also list Australia as one of the major nationalities receiving medical services in Vietnam.

However, the surge in cross-border dental tourism has also raised concerns among professionals regarding quality and safety. Scott Davis, spokesperson for the Australian Dental Association (ADA), pointed out that patients undergoing surgery overseas often face risks such as complications, insufficient legal protection, and complex compensation procedures. Davis emphasized that cross-border treatment often attempts to compress a normal 3-6 month treatment course into two weeks, which violates biological principles.
